Spanish Language Support for Kiosk Consents and Custom Forms

This update introduces Spanish language support for consents and custom forms within the Kiosk application. Patients can access and sign consents specifically aligned with their selected language i.e. English or Spanish, enhancing clarity and efficiency during check-in. Providers can manually assign language tags to consents, ensuring targeted and accurate communication. If consents aren't language-tagged, Kiosk will show all available consents by default. This enhancement significantly improves accessibility and provides a more personalized, professional experience for multilingual patient populations.

Ability to Attach Consent/Custom Forms to Appointment Reasons

With this enhancement, users can attach consent and custom forms to appointment reasons. Patients using KIOSK can only view the forms applicable to their appointment reason.

Introduction to CureMD KIOSK

We are excited to present our new application for iPad known by the name of CureMD KIOSK. CureMD KIOSK allows patients to Register, Schedule and even check themselves in. Patients can update their patient profiles, contact information, add insurance details and view and sign consent forms with little to no intervention from practice staff.
